What is a leeward side of a mountain?

What is a leeward side of a mountain? The opposite side of the mountain is called the leeward side and usually sees much less precipitation. How did the Pure Food and Drug Act affect society?

How did the Pure Food and Drug Act affect society? The Pure Food and Drug Act of 1906 prohibited the sale of misbranded or adulterated food and drugs in interstate commerce and laid a foundation for the nation’s first consumer protection agency, the Food and Drug Administration (FDA). Why do Acids burn?

Why do Acids burn? An acid is a substance that separates readily into charged hydrogen ions (H+). These charged ions undergo catalytic reactions named amide/ester hydrolysis, that eventually cause the destruction of proteins and lipids in biological tissue, and therefore the chemical burn.
